> > No, I understand that. The question is, why does MAME not recognize -joystick_map
> for
> > keyboard controls?
>
> Because the problems it's intended to fix (primarily analog stick deadzones and 4-way
> vs 8-way) don't exist on keyboards. E.g. if you want to banish diagonals for 4-way
> games you can pick 4 keys far enough apart from each other that it's not a thing.
> It's called joystick_map for a good, descriptive reason

But for the many of us that use keyboard encoders for our joysticks and buttons, it's a problem. My HAPP joysticks and buttons are mapped to keys. I'm betting the vast majority of MAME cabinets use keyboard encoders, thus suffer the same problem. And even if you're only using the arrow keys, it's still easy to hit two keys, especially in games like pacman where you are constantly turning 90 degrees.

Is there a way to force the joystick map to be used when using a keyboard? Because technically, the keyboard is emulating a joystick, thus the problem exists.
